Abstract(in English) This study considered a method of extracting cooccurrence relation of keywords to visualize the knowledge chain from HTML document corpus. The TermLinker system has a function to extracting cooccurrence relation of keywords from document sentences using text mining. The system can visualize the knowledge chain linking extracted cooccurrence relation of keywords with concept network. Proposed method creates partial knowledge hierarchy automatically by concept network. User can interact with the system and manipulate the mapped keywords that remind user to new terms and relation sips which users forgot or do not remind.
